A search for heavy neutral lepton production in K+ decays using a data sample collected with a minimum bias trigger by the NA62 experiment at CERN in 2015 is reported. Upper limits at the 10⁻⁷ to 10⁻⁶ level are established on the elements of the extended neutrino mixing matrix |Ue4|² and |Uμ4|² for heavy neutral lepton mass in the ranges 170–448 MeV/c² and 250–373 MeV/c², respectively. This improves on the previous limits from HNL production searches over the whole mass range considered for |Ue4|², and above 300 MeV/c² for |Uμ4|².
